



Charles Davis is a Funky, Rock/R&B drummer with a passion for marching percussion. He has been playing drums for 30 years; and has studied the drum set with Steve Michaud and Mike Mangini. He has also studied Drum Corps/Marching Percussion technique under the instruction of Chris Dufault. Charles has resided in Nashua, New Hampshire for over 20 years.
Charles credits his “Uncle Bennie” as his first influence in drumming. He first picked up the sticks at age 6 after watching his uncle play, and shortly thereafter joined the Kingsmen Drum and Bugle Corps in Fitchburg, MA; this was Charles first experience at diversifying himself in different areas of percussion. At age 18 he joined the Spartans Drum and Bugle Corps and continued to learn the ins and outs of marching percussion, while still continuing to become skilled at the drum set. That same year, while still in high school, Charles was selected to participate in the percussion section for the All State Band. In, 1990 Charles was introduced to local drum instructor Steve Michaud, who at the time was one of Gary Chaffee’s top students. Steve opened the door to Jazz, Latin, and Fusion.
Charles began instructing the Spartans in 1994 giving him the opportunity to return to his Drum Corp roots. In 1999 he began to teach in the Nashua School District as an Elementary Instrumental Instructor, as well as teaching privately out of his home. In 2004, Charles became the Nashua High School Marching Band Percussion Instructor/Arranger and continues his work there. In the spring of 2005 Charles had the privilege to study with world class drummer Mike Mangini from Berklee. In 2006 Charles began teaching privately at Music’s Cool Academy of Music in Londonderry, NH as an instructor, and continues his work there. During the same year Charles toured locally with the Mike Forkuo Project a Christian based acoustic, rock, soul band. www.myspace.com/michaelforkuo.
Charles is also a choir member and lead drummer for the New Hope Community Church in Ayer, MA.
